Analysis of the Vanguard Health Care ETF (VHT) reveals a significant bullish signal from corporate insiders, with 19.8% of the ETF's weighted holdings experiencing insider buying over the past six months. This trend is exemplified by specific component stocks, notably Teleflex Incorporated (TFX) and Establishment Labs Holdings Inc (ESTA). At TFX, a 0.09% holding, five distinct directors and officers, including the Chairman, President & CEO, collectively purchased over $633,000 worth of stock at prices around $115 per share, below its recent trade of $119.99. This broad-based buying from senior leadership represents a strong vote of confidence in the company's valuation and prospects. Similarly, at ESTA, a 0.01% holding, the CEO and a director acquired shares valued at over $277,000, with purchase prices ranging from $34.30 to $37.85, also below the recent trade of $39.11. While these companies are minor constituents of VHT, the clustered and high-level nature of these open-market purchases serves as a powerful indicator of management's belief that their respective stocks are undervalued.
